Maison  >  Article  >  interface Web  >  Que sont les fonctions intégrées à Javascript ?

Que sont les fonctions intégrées à Javascript ?

青灯夜游
青灯夜游original
2022-02-16 17:49:373815parcourir

En JavaScript, les fonctions intégrées font référence aux fonctions fournies avec le noyau du navigateur et peuvent être utilisées directement sans introduire de bibliothèque de fonctions. Les fonctions intégrées courantes peuvent être divisées en cinq catégories : 1. Fonctions régulières ; 2. Fonctions de tableau ; 3. Fonctions de date ; 4. Fonctions mathématiques ;

Que sont les fonctions intégrées à Javascript ?

L'environnement d'exploitation de ce tutoriel : système Windows 7, JavaScript version 1.8.5, ordinateur Dell G3.

Fonctions intégrées en javascript

Les fonctions intégrées de js sont des fonctions fournies avec le noyau du navigateur et peuvent être utilisées directement sans introduire de bibliothèque de fonctions.

Les fonctions intégrées courantes peuvent être divisées en cinq catégories :

1, fonctions régulières

2, fonctions de tableau

3, fonctions de date

4, fonctions mathématiques

5, fonctions de chaîne

Premier Classe : Fonction régulière

comprend les 9 fonctions suivantes :

(1) fonction d'alerte : affiche une boîte de dialogue d'avertissement, comprenant un bouton OK.

(2)fonction de confirmation : affiche une boîte de dialogue de confirmation, comprenant les boutons OK et Annuler.

(3)fonction d'échappement : convertissez les caractères en codes Unicode.

(4)fonction eval : calcule le résultat d'une expression.

(5)fonction isNaN : teste si (vrai) ou non (faux) n'est pas un nombre.

(6)fonction parseFloat : convertit une chaîne en forme numérique pointée.

(7)fonction parseInt : convertit la chaîne sous forme numérique entière (le système décimal peut être spécifié).

(8)fonction d'invite : affiche une boîte de dialogue de saisie, invitant à attendre la saisie de l'utilisateur.

Deuxième catégorie : Fonction Tableau

comprend les 4 fonctions suivantes :

(1) fonction de jointure : Convertit et connecte tous les éléments du tableau en une chaîne.

(2)fonction langth : renvoie la longueur du tableau.

(3)fonction reverse : inversez l'ordre des éléments du tableau.

(4)fonction de tri : réorganisez les éléments du tableau.

Catégorie 3 : Fonction Date

comprend les 20 fonctions suivantes :

(1)fonction getDate : renvoie la partie "jour" de la date, avec une valeur de 1~31

(2)fonction getDay : renvoie le jour de la semaine, la valeur est 0~6, où 0 signifie dimanche, 1 signifie lundi,..., 6 signifie samedi

(3) fonction getHours : renvoie la partie "heure" de la date, la valeur est 0 ~ 23.

(4)fonction getMinutes : renvoie la partie "minutes" de la date, la valeur est 0~59. Voir l'exemple ci-dessus.

(5)fonction getMonth : renvoie la partie "mois" de la date, la valeur est 0~11. Parmi eux, 0 représente janvier, 2 représente mars, ... et 11 représente décembre. Voir exemple précédent.

(6)fonction getSeconds : renvoie la partie "secondes" de la date, la valeur est 0~59. Voir exemple précédent.

(7)Fonction getTime : renvoie l'heure du système.

(8)Fonction getTimezoneOffset : renvoie le décalage horaire dans cette région (le décalage horaire régional entre l'heure locale et l'heure GMT de Greenwich), en minutes.

(9)fonction getYear : renvoie la partie "année" de la date. La valeur de retour est basée sur 1900, par exemple, 1999 est 99.

(10)fonction d'analyse : renvoie le nombre de millisecondes depuis 0h00 le 1er janvier 1970 (heure locale).

(11)fonction setDate : définit la partie "jour" de la date, la valeur est de 0 à 31.

(12)fonction setHours : définissez la partie "heure" de la date, la valeur est de 0 à 23.

(13)fonction setMinutes : définissez la partie "minutes" de la date, la valeur est de 0 à 59.

(14)fonction setMonth : définit la partie "mois" de la date, la valeur est de 0 à 11. Parmi eux, 0 représente janvier, ... et 11 représente décembre.

(15)fonction setSeconds : définissez la partie "secondes" de la date, la valeur est de 0 à 59.

(16)fonction setTime : régler l'heure. La valeur temporelle est le nombre de millisecondes depuis 00h00 le 1er janvier 1970.

(17)fonction setYear : définit la partie "année" de la date.

(18)fonction toGMTString : convertit la date en une chaîne, qui correspond à l'heure GMT de Greenwich.

(19)Fonction setLocaleString : convertit la date en chaîne et l'heure locale.

(20)Fonction UTC : renvoie le nombre de millisecondes depuis 00h00 le 1er janvier 1970, calculé en GMT Greenwich Mean Time.

var myDate=new Date(dtime.replace(/-|\./g,"/"));
myDate.getYear();        //获取当前年份(2位)
myDate.getFullYear();    //获取完整的年份(4位,1970-????)
myDate.getMonth();       //获取当前月份(0-11,0代表1月)
myDate.getDate();        //获取当前日(1-31)
myDate.getDay();         //获取当前星期X(0-6,0代表星期天)
myDate.getTime();        //获取当前时间(从1970.1.1开始的毫秒数)
myDate.getHours();       //获取当前小时数(0-23)
myDate.getMinutes();     //获取当前分钟数(0-59)
myDate.getSeconds();     //获取当前秒数(0-59)
myDate.getMilliseconds();    //获取当前毫秒数(0-999)
myDate.toLocaleDateString();     //获取当前日期
var mytime=myDate.toLocaleTimeString();     //获取当前时间
myDate.toLocaleString( );        //获取日期与时间

setTimeout();
setInterval();

Catégorie 4 : Fonctions mathématiques

Il existe les 18 fonctions suivantes :

(1) fonction abs : Math.abs (la même ci-dessous), renvoie la valeur absolue d'un nombre.

(2) Fonction acos : renvoie la valeur cosinus inverse d'un nombre, et le résultat est 0~π radians (radians).

(3)fonction asin : renvoie la valeur de l'arc sinus d'un nombre et le résultat est -π/2~π/2 radians.

(4)fonction atan : renvoie la valeur arctangente d'un nombre et le résultat est -π/2~π/2 radians.

(5)fonction atan2 : renvoie la valeur de l'angle de coordonnée polaire d'une coordonnée.

(6)fonction ceil : renvoie la plus petite valeur entière d'un nombre (supérieur ou égal à).

(7)fonction cos : renvoie la valeur cosinus d'un nombre et le résultat est -1~1.

(8)fonction exp : renvoie la valeur de puissance de e (logarithme naturel).

(9)fonction floor : renvoie la valeur entière maximale d'un nombre (inférieur ou égal à).

(10)fonction log : fonction de logarithme naturel, renvoie la valeur du logarithme naturel (e) d'un nombre. Fonction

(11)max : renvoie la valeur maximale de deux nombres. Fonction

(12)min : renvoie la valeur minimale de deux nombres.

(13)fonction pow : renvoie la puissance d'un nombre.

(14)fonction aléatoire : renvoie une valeur aléatoire comprise entre 0 et 1.

(15)fonction round : Renvoie la valeur arrondie d'un nombre, le type est entier.

(16) fonction sin : renvoie la valeur sinusoïdale d'un nombre, et le résultat est -1~1.

(17)fonction sqrt : renvoie la valeur de la racine carrée d'un nombre.

(18)fonction tan : renvoie la valeur tangente d'un nombre.

Catégorie 5 : Fonctions de chaîne

comprend les 20 fonctions suivantes :

(1) fonction d'ancrage : génère un point de lien (ancre) à utiliser comme lien hypertexte. La fonction d'ancrage définit le nom du point de lien de c15da42579d2d9c6ecf2a46a5b849f87, et l'autre fonction link définit l'adresse URL de 6a2b3936541eb5c40626a82687b7bf27.

(2)grande fonction : augmentez la taille de la police à une taille, ce qui est identique à la balise 3d02d2b72512d32efd84db2a3fbe32fb...ef5b80551b88d71b4f5c2372c2b9bb54.

(3)fonction de clignotement : fait clignoter la chaîne, ce qui est identique au résultat de la balise 3b3a554c1e8af6bf860b725ec2cb8eb5...750b65b808e1470e3380ad614e2857c0

(4)fonction gras : mettez la police en gras, ce qui est la même que la balise 9368c5823948a595f9974a5e2b3bd3f1...41908b66e4bc50a75b443e0dfafd01f9

(5) fonction charAt : renvoie un certain caractère spécifié dans la chaîne.

(6) fonction fixe : définissez la police sur une police à largeur fixe, le même résultat que la balise 93d6511c7669df5bfbcd3880050b7aa3...4b3fc97737cbf18af15f2ba7bc5d77cd.

(7)fonction fontcolor : définissez la couleur de la police, qui est la même que le résultat de la balise 6a4d2ef975a8d4f254d1af10ffb7960e

(8)fonction fontsize : définissez la taille de la police, qui est la même que le résultat de la balise b199633d0149a1f3cd04d7545e597261

(9)fonction indexOf : renvoie le premier index trouvé dans la chaîne, en commençant par la gauche.

(10) fonction italique : rend la police en italique, de la même manière que le résultat de la balise 7a282450d175f90c7a1cab18e4a7ad13...a7d43287c9e69e794166deeac33b9b9c

(11)fonction lastIndexOf : renvoie le premier index trouvé dans la chaîne, en commençant par la droite.

(12)fonction length : renvoie la longueur de la chaîne. (Sans parenthèses)

(13) fonction de lien : générer un lien hypertexte, ce qui équivaut à définir l'adresse URL de 6a2b3936541eb5c40626a82687b7bf27.

(14)petite fonction : réduisez la taille de la police d'une taille, ce qui est identique à l'étiquette f6dce2e98bcc85bf3f7857c7e659d426...e6f9f92b3bbf3b903b7868786feefc5d.

(15)fonction strike : Ajoutez une ligne horizontale au milieu du texte, même résultat que la balise 57cd6b64c8b9044cd4fad141699574a0...d5a0e3f5d79f9603e2d1a28898a2f705

(16)sub fonction : affiche la chaîne en indice.

(17)fonction de sous-chaîne : renvoie plusieurs caractères spécifiés dans la chaîne.

(18)sup fonction : affiche la chaîne en exposant.

(19)fonction toLowerCase : convertit la chaîne en minuscules.

(20)fonction toUpperCase : convertit la chaîne en majuscule.

【Recommandations associées : Tutoriel d'apprentissage Javascript

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n